Description:
Explore the intricacies of Hochschild cohomology in uniform Roe algebras through this 39-minute conference talk by Matthew Lorentz at the Fields Institute. Delve into the findings from Lorentz and Rufus Willett's paper on bounded derivations, and examine the conditions for vanishing Hochschild cohomology groups. Investigate the relationship between norm continuous and ultraweak-weak* continuous Hochschild cohomology in uniform Roe algebras. Cover topics such as bounded geometry, multilinear maps, co-boundary operators, and weakly continuous maps in this comprehensive exploration of cyclic cohomology.
